Q1 2026 earnings summary
12 May, 2026Executive summary
Gross written premiums rose 24% year-over-year to $217 million for Q1 2026, led by strong growth in Casualty and Healthcare Liability divisions and significant gains in digital underwriting via Baleen and Express platforms.
Net income reached $16 million, or $0.48 per diluted share, up 40.1% year-over-year, with adjusted ROAE of 14.1%.
Digital underwriting (Baleen and Express) contributed nearly 7% of total GWP, with Baleen premiums tripling year-over-year and Express generating $3 million in premium.
The company operates as a single segment, focusing on specialty commercial property and casualty insurance in the U.S., with a clean balance sheet and no reserves from accident years prior to 2020.
Led by an experienced management team, supported by a strategic partnership with AmFam, and robust growth demonstrated by a 48% GWP CAGR from Q1'21 to Q1'26.
Financial highlights
Gross written premiums increased 24% year-over-year to $217 million; net earned premiums grew 24.6% to $136.8 million.
Adjusted net income was $16 million, up 40% year-over-year; diluted adjusted EPS was $0.48.
Loss ratio was 66.9%, flat year-over-year; expense ratio improved to 28.4% from 30.4%.
Combined ratio improved to 95.3% from 97.3% a year ago.
Net investment income rose 43.5% year-over-year to $18 million, with a portfolio yield of 4.6% and AA- average credit rating.
Outlook and guidance
Management expects continued profitable growth, leveraging both craft and digital underwriting models, with digital platforms expected to increase their share of total GWP.
Expecting around 20% GWP growth for the year, supported by expanded reinsurance agreements.
Expense ratio expected to remain below 30% for the remainder of the year.
Commitment to long-term value creation and strong returns, with a strategy to expand into new lines and markets as opportunities arise.
No material impact anticipated from recent amendments to the AmFam Quota Share Agreement.
